Web22 feb. 2024 · The payer is required to send Form W2G only if the winner reaches the following thresholds: The winnings (not reduced by the wager) are $1,200 or more from a bingo game or slot machine The winnings (reduced by the wager) are $1,500 or more from a keno game The winnings (reduced by the wager or buy-in) are more than $5,000 from a … brenlin company herman mn

You get a 1099 and pay ordinary income … Web27 jun. 2024 · How much tax do you pay if you win a prize? The tax rate will be determined by your income. So, for instance, if you make $42,000 annually and file as single, your federal tax rate is 22%. If you win $1,000, your total income is $43,000, and your tax rate is still 22%.
